FoxPro/Visual FoxPro - Visual Fox - Excel

 
Vista:

Visual Fox - Excel

Publicado por Eduardo Flores (4 intervenciones) el 12/07/2004 23:51:24
Saludos:
Estoy realizando varios reportes desde fox y que generan hojas de calculo en excel, con diversa informacion.
Necesito realizar la siguiente operacion..... como saben en excel una hoja de calculo con formulas la podemos dejar simplemente con valores, se realiza un pegado especial ( copiar - pegar valores ) y listo....mi pregunta es como mando esa instruccion desde fox ???
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il

RE:Visual Fox - Excel

Publicado por Frederick (38 intervenciones) el 11/11/2004 21:34:48
si tu problema es solo el envio de informacion desde una tabla a un archivo de excel te puedo recomendar algo ...
- Crea tu "esqueleto" en Excel con los encabezados necesarios, x ejemplo c:\temp\HojaExcel.xls
- Ahora lo unico que necesitas.. son unas lineas como estas

var_Excel =crea ("excel.application")
archivo = "c:\temp\hojaExcel.xls"
var_Excel.workbooks.open(archivo)
var_Excel.sheets ('hoja1').select &&Con esto seleccionas la hoja
var_Excel.Cells(3,2).value = tabla.campo &&asi asignas a las celdas
.
. &&Aqui llena las demas
.
var_Excel.application.visible = .t. &&con esto abres excell
release var_Excel &&liberas la variable

todo lo demas k necesitas es crear algunos ciclos para descargar tu informacion en las columnas q desees

Ojala y te sirva de algo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ar